Basement leak repair services focus on identifying and resolving sources of water intrusion that affect the lower levels of a property. These services typically involve inspecting the foundation, walls, and flooring to locate leaks caused by cracks, faulty plumbing, or improper drainage. Once the source of the leak is determined, contractors may perform repairs such as sealing cracks, installing waterproof membranes, or replacing damaged materials to prevent further water infiltration. The goal is to restore the basement’s dryness and structural integrity, helping to protect the property from ongoing damage.
Leaks in basements can lead to a variety of problems, including mold growth, wood rot, and deterioration of building materials. Excess moisture can also cause musty odors and compromise indoor air quality. Over time, persistent leaks may weaken the foundation, increasing the risk of structural issues. Basement leak repair services address these concerns by stopping water intrusion at its source, thereby reducing the likelihood of mold development and structural damage. This preventative approach can save property owners from costly repairs in the future and maintain a healthier indoor environment.

The overview below groups typical Basement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Southfield,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range for Leak Detection - The typical cost for identifying basement leaks varies from $150 to $500, depending on the complexity of the issue. For example, simple leak detection might be closer to $150, while extensive inspections can approach $500.
Repair Expenses - Repair costs for basement leaks generally span from $500 to $2,500, influenced by the leak’s size and location. Minor repairs may cost around $500, whereas significant repairs or extensive patching can reach $2,500 or more.
Material and Labor Costs - The combined expense of materials and labor for leak repairs often falls between $1,000 and $4,000. Factors such as waterproofing systems and structural repairs can increase the overall price.
Additional Service Fees - Additional costs may include moisture barriers or drainage system installations, which can add $1,000 to $3,000 to the total. These services are typically provided by local contractors specializing in basement waterproofing.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es basement leaks? Basement leaks can result from issues such as foundation cracks, plumbing failures, or poor drainage around the property.
How can I tell if my basement has a leak? Signs include water stains, damp walls, musty odors, or visible puddles on the floor.
What methods do professionals use to repair basement leaks? Local service providers may use techniques like sealing cracks, installing waterproofing membranes, or improving drainage systems.
Are basement leak repairs disruptive? Repair methods vary, and professionals can often perform work with minimal disruption to your home.
How can I prevent future basement leaks? Proper drainage, regular inspections, and timely repairs of existing issues can help prevent leaks from recurring.
